Has anyone here had AutoZone, etc pull the codes for a 4 wheel ABS system ( ABS light on solid)?

I was wondering who has the proper equipment to do this (not a standard scan tool function), although the ABS module is accessible via the same ODB-II connector - it's on the same bus.

Where I live , everyone wants about $100 just to pull the code, which is all of 5 minutes work.

I'm travelling to the US for the holidays ( where it's warm ;-)) and was hoping to get this done for a more reasonable fee.

I understand places like AutoZone will pull the standard powertrain ABS codes for free if you ask them nicely.. and I'd like to know if they have the stuff to do this for the ABS system...

I tried the standard fix - rear ABS sensor - and of course that was not it.

Autozone's scan tool only reads PCM codes & can't access the ABS module. You need a scan tool & software that has the capability to do this, such as a monitor 4000E, ect.
